253 clinics specializing in Spine surgery providing treatment of Traumatic central cord syndrome Traumatic central cord syndrome is a spinal cord injury resulting from trauma to the central part of the spinal cord. It causes weakness and sensory loss in the upper limbs more than the lower limbs. Rehabilitation plays a crucial role in recovery. disease in Asia.
